We are shorlty to issue 40 PDA's to our service technicians to handle breakdown calls. Callout info is sent to the DPA via GPRS. The fact they have GPRS means all 40 PDA's will also have internet access. As GPRS is chagrged by the byte we would rather internet access was not available as we forsee this being abused by some.

Is there any way to block internet access on Windows Mobile 2003 with GPRS still enabled for 3rd party application data access?

I could try to remove IE however we have technical info on the PDA's in HTML format therefore this is not an option.

Any suggestions would be appreciated.

Not a perfect solution, but better than nothing - remove the PIE icon from the menu and any links the user might have added. This still allows HTML to be read through PIE but unless the user is savvy enough to look for and manually run PIE, they won't find it on the menu and be tempted - out of sight, out of mind. A company policy with possible discipline is also good - use the Internet and your pay gets docked. It's amazing how a hit to the paycheck gets people's attention.
